✦ Synopsis
We report the low-temperature (\left(\sim 0^{\circ} \mathrm{C}\right)) synthesis and (\mathrm{X})-ray single-crystal structure of (\mathrm{Na}{2} \mathrm{Zn}\left(\mathrm{HPO}{4}\right) \cdot 4!\mathrm{I}{2} \mathrm{O}), a new layered material, whose structure is built up from sheets of vertex-sharing (\mathrm{ZnO}{4}) and (\mathrm{HPO}{4}) tetrahedra, which encapsulate octahedrally coordinated "guest" sodium cations and water molecules. The (\mathrm{Zn} / \mathrm{P}) tetrahedral-atom connectivity in (\mathrm{Na}{2} \mathrm{Zn}\left(\mathrm{HPO}{4}\right){2} \cdot 4 \mathrm{H}{2} \mathrm{O}) results in a twodimensional network of layers of "bifurcated," tetrahedral 12rings, with interlayer connectivity established only by sodium cations and via (\mathrm{H}) bonds. (\mathrm{X})-ray powder data and ({ }^{3!} \mathrm{P}) MAS NMR spectra are consistent with those expected from the crystal structure data. Crystal data are (\mathrm{Na}{2} \mathrm{Zn}\left(\mathrm{HPO}{4}\right){2} \cdot \mathbf{4 H}{2} \mathrm{O}\left(\mathrm{ZnNa}{2} \mathrm{P}{2} \mathrm{O}{12} \mathrm{H}{10}\right)), (M{\mathrm{r}}=375.37), monoclinic, space group (P 2_{1} / c) (No. 14), (a=8.947) (2) (\AA, b=13.254(2) \AA, c=10.098(2) \AA, \beta=116.358(6)^{\circ}, V=1074.5) (\AA^{3}, Z=4, R=4.25 %), and (R_{\mathrm{w}}=5.68 %) [ 1608 unique reflections with (I>3 \sigma(I)]).
